Overview

Database Administrator is responsible for management and maintenance of a variety of database environments. They are required to maintain adherence to the data management policy and ensure that databases are secure, backed up, and optimized.

Qualifications
  • Minimum:
    Bachelor’s degree in computer science, computer engineering, programming, or a related field
  • Experience of SQL and SQL server tools
  • Excellent knowledge of database security, backup and recovery, and performance monitoring standards
  • Understanding of relational and dimensional data modeling
  • Experience with variety of database technologies (including MySQL, Oracle)
  • Familiarity with SSAS, SSIS, SSRS and other integration, reporting and analytical tools
  • Experience of working with on-prem and cloud based database technologies
  • Power Shell and Unix shell scripting skills
Key Competencies
  • Need to be conversant with structured query language (SQL) and relevant database technologies
  •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ills
  • Business awareness and understanding of business requirements of IT
  • Understand coding and service management
  • Good communication, teamwork, and negotiation skills
Responsibilities
  • Assists in database support activities
  • Manage database access
  • Be available for on-call support as needed
  • Performs standard database maintenance and administration tasks
  • Uses database management system software and tools to collect performance statistics
  • Diagnose and troubleshoot database errors
  • Develop processes for optimizing database security
  • Develops and configures tools to enable automation of database administration tasks
  • Monitors performance statistics and create reports
  • Identifies and investigates complex problems and issues and recommends corrective actions
  • Performs routine configuration, installation, and reconfiguration of database and related products
